Cyclopentylamine is an organic compound with the formula C5H9NH2. It is a colorless, readily distillable liquid. Cyclopentylamine is a member of the aminocycloalkanes, which also includes cyclopropylamine, cyclobutylamine, and cyclohexylamine.

Cyclopentylamine can be prepared by reductive amination starting with cyclopentanone or cyclopentanol.[1]
